### Client Configuration
You can configure the client (the JS part) via `data-` attributes:
* data-title
When you start a new thread (= first comment on a page), Isso sends
a GET request that page to see if it a) exists and b) parse the site's
heading (currently used as subject in emails).
Isso assumes that the title is inside an `h1` tag near the isso thread:
```html
<html>
<body>
<h1>Website Title</h1>
<article>
<header>
<h1>Post Title</h1>
<section id="isso-thread">
...
```
In this example, the detected title is `Post Title` as expected, but some
older sites may only use a single `h1` as their website's maintitle, and
a `h2` for the post title. Unfortunately this is unambiguous and you have
to tell Isso what's the actual post title:
```html
<section data-title="Post Title" id="isso-thread">
```
Make sure to escape the attribute value.
* data-isso
Isso usually detects the REST API automatically, but when you serve the JS
script on a different location, this may fail. Use `data-isso` to
override the API location:
```html
<script data-isso="/isso" src="/path/to/embed.min.js"></script>
```
* data-isso-css
Set to `false` prevents Isso from automatically appending the stylesheet.
Defaults to `true`.
```html
<script src="..." data-isso-css="false"></script>
```
* data-isso-lang
Override useragent's preferred language. Currently available: german (de),
english (en) and french (fr).
* data-isso-reply-to-self
Set to `true` when spam guard is configured with `reply-to-self = true`.

Setup
=====
Sub-URI
-------
You can run Isso on the same domain as your website, which circumvents issues
originating from CORS_. Also, privacy-protecting browser addons such as
`Request Policy`_ wont block comments.
.. code-block:: nginx
server {
listen [::]:80;
listen [::]:443 ssl;
server_name example.tld;
root /var/www/example.tld;
location /isso {
proxy_set_header X-Forwarded-For $proxy_add_x_forwarded_for;
proxy_set_header X-Script-Name /isso;
proxy_pass http://localhost:8080;
}
}
Now, the website integration is just as described in :doc:`../quickstart` but
with a different location.
.. _CORS: https://developer.mozilla.org/en/docs/HTTP/Access_control_CORS
.. _Request Policy: https://www.requestpolicy.com/

Isso API
========
The Isso API uses HTTP and JSON as primary communication protocol.
JSON format
-----------
When querying the API you either get an error, an object or list of
objects representing the comment. Here's a example JSON returned from
Isso:
.. code-block:: js
{
"text": "Hello, World!",
"author": "Bernd",
"website": null,
"votes": 0,
"mode": 1,
"id": 1,
"parent": null,
"hash": "68b329da9893e34099c7d8ad5cb9c940",
"created": 1379001637.50,
"modified": null
}
text : required, comment as HTML
author : author's name, may be ``null``
website : author's website, may be ``null``
votes : sum of up- and downvotes, defaults to zero.
mode : \* 1, accepted comment \* 2, comment in moderation queue \* 4,
comment deleted, but is referenced
id : unique comment number per thread
parent : answer to a parent id, may be ``null``
hash : user identification, used to generate identicons
created : time in seconds sinde epoch
modified : last modification time in seconds, may be ``null``
List comments
-------------
List all visible comments for a thread. Does not include deleted and
comments currently in moderation queue.
GET /?uri=path
You must encode ``path``, e.g. to retrieve comments for
``/hello-world/``:
::
GET /?uri=%2Fhello-world%2F
To disable automatic Markdown-to-HTML conversion, pass ``plain=1`` to
the query URL:
::
GET /?uri=...&plain=1
As response, you either get 200, 400, or 404, which are pretty
self-explanatory.
::
GET /
400 BAD REQUEST
GET /?uri=%2Fhello-world%2F
404 NOT FOUND
GET /?uri=%2Fcomment-me%2F
[{comment 1}, {comment 2}, ...]

Multi Site Configuration
========================
Isso is designed to serve comments for a single website and therefore stores
comments for a relative URL to support HTTP, HTTPS and even domain transfers
without manual intervention. But you can chain Isso to support multiple
websites on different domains.
The following example uses `gunicorn <http://gunicorn.org/>`_ as WSGI server (
you can use uWSGI as well). Let's say you maintain two websites, like
foo.example and other.foo:
.. code-block:: bash
$ cat /etc/isso.d/foo.example.cfg
[general]
host = http://foo.example/
dbpath = /var/lib/isso/foo.example.db
$ cat /etc/isso.d/other.foo.cfg
[general]
host = http://other.foo/
dbpath = /var/lib/isso/other.foo.db
Then you run Isso using gunicorn:
.. code-block:: bash
$ export ISSO_SETTINGS="/etc/isso.d/foo.example.cfg;/etc/isso.d/other.foo.cfg"
$ gunicorn isso.dispatch -b localhost:8080
In your webserver configuration, proxy Isso as usual:
.. code-block:: nginx
server {
listen [::]:80;
server_name comments.example;
location / {
proxy_pass http://localhost:8080;
proxy_set_header X-Forwarded-For $proxy_add_x_forwarded_for;
proxy_set_header X-Real-IP $remote_addr;
}
}
To verify the setup, run:
.. code-block:: bash
$ curl -vH "Origin: http://foo.example" http://comments.example/
...
$ curl -vH "Origin: http://other.foo" http://comments.example/
...
In case of a 418 (I'm a teapot), the setup is *not* correctly configured.

uWSGI
=====
In short: `uWSGI <http://uwsgi-docs.readthedocs.org/>`_ is awesome. Isso
has builtin support for it (and simple fallback if uWSGI is not
available). Use uWSGI if you think that the builtin WSGI server is a bad
choice or slow (hint: it's both).
With uWSGI, you have roughly 100% performance improvements for just
using it. Instead of one thread per request, you can use multiple
processes, hence it is more "web scale". Other side effects: spooling,
fast inter-process caching.
Installation
------------
You need uWSGI 1.9 or higher, fortunately you can install it with
Python:
.. code-block:: sh
~> apt-get install build-essential python-dev
~> pip install uwsgi
Configuration
-------------
For convenience, I recommend a INI-style configuration (you can also
supply everything as command-line arguments):
.. code-block:: ini
[uwsgi]
http = :8080
master = true
processes = 4
cache2 = name=hash,items=1024,blocksize=32
spooler = %d/mail
module = isso
virtualenv = %d
env = ISSO_SETTINGS=%d/sample.cfg
You shoud adjust ``processes`` to your CPU count. Then, save this file
to a directory if choice. Next to this file, create an empty directory
called ``mail``:
.. code-block:: sh
~> mkdir mail/
~> ls
uwsgi.ini mail/
Now start Isso:
.. code-block:: sh
~> uwsgi /path/to/uwsgi.ini

Overview
========
Welcome to the Isso's documentation. This documentation will help you get
started fast. If you get any problems when using Isso, you can find the answer
in troubleshooting or you can ask me on IRC or GitHub.
What's Isso?
------------
Isso is a lightweight commenting server similar to Disqus. It allows anonymous
comments, maintains identity and is simple to administrate. It uses JavaScript
and cross-origin ressource sharing for easy integration into static websites.
No, I meant "Isso"
------------------
Isso is an informal, german abbreviation for "Ich schrei sonst!", which can
roughly be translated to "I'm yelling otherwise". It usually ends the
discussion without any further arguments.
In germany, Isso `is also pokémon N° 360`__.
.. __: http://bulbapedia.bulbagarden.net/wiki/Wynaut_(Pok%C3%A9mon)
What's wrong with Disqus?
-------------------------
No anonymous comments (IP address, email and name recorded), hosted in the USA,
third-party. Just like IntenseDebate, livefrye etc. When you embed Disqus, they
can do anything with your readers (and probably mine Bitcoins, see the loading
times).
Isso is not the first open-source commenting server:
* `talkatv <https://github.com/talkatv/talkatv>`_, written in Python.
Unfortunately, talkatv's (read "talkative") development stalled. Neither
anonymous nor threaded comments.
* `Juvia <https://github.com/phusion/juvia>`_, written in Ruby (on Rails).
No threaded comments, nice administration webinterface, but... yeah... Ruby.
* `Tildehash.com <http://www.tildehash.com/?article=why-im-reinventing-disqus>`_,
written in PHP. Did I forgot something?
* `Unobtrusive, self-hosted comments <http://stackoverflow.com/q/2053217>`_,
discussion on StackOverflow.

Quickstart
==========
Assuming you have successfully :doc:`installed <install>` Isso, here's
a quickstart quide that covers common setups.
Configuration
-------------
You must provide a custom configuration. Most default parameters are useful for
development, not persistence. Two most important options are `dbpath` to set
the location of your database and `host` which is your website:
.. code-block:: ini
[general]
; database location, check permissions
dbpath = /var/lib/isso/comments.db
; your website or blog (not the location of Isso!)
host = http://example.tld/
; you can add multiple hosts for local development
; or SSL connections. There is no wildcard to allow
; any domain.
host =
http://localhost:1234/
http://example.tld/
https://example.tld/
Note, that multiple, *different* websites are **not** supported in a single
configuration. To serve comments for diffent websites, refer to
:ref:`Multiple Sites <configure-multiple-sites>`.
You moderate Isso through signed URLs sent by email or logged. By default,
comments are accepted and immediately shown to other users. To enable
moderation queue, add:
.. code-block:: ini
[moderation]
enabled = true
To moderate comments, either use the activation or deletion URL in the logs or
:ref:`use SMTP <configure-smtp>` to get notified on new comments including the
URLs for activation and deletion:
.. code-block:: ini
[general]
notify = smtp
[smtp]
; SMTP settings
Migration
---------
You can migrate your existing comments from Disqus_. Log into Disqus, go to
your website, click on *Discussions* and select the *Export* tab. You'll
receive an email with your comments. Unfortunately, Disqus does not export
up- and downvotes.
To import existing comments, run Isso with your new configuration file:
.. code-block:: sh
~> isso -c /path/to/isso.cfg import user-2013-09-02T11_39_22.971478-all.xml
[100%] 53 threads, 192 comments
.. _Disqus: <https://disqus.com/>
Running Isso
------------
To run Isso, simply execute:
.. code-block:: sh
$ isso -c /path/to/isso.cfg run
2013-11-25 15:31:34,773 INFO: connected to HTTP server
Next, we configure Nginx_ to proxy Isso. Do not run Isso on a public interface!
A popular but often error-prone (because of CORS_) setup to host Isso uses a
dedicated domain such as ``comments.example.tld``; see
:doc:`configuration/setup` for alternate ways.
Assuming both, your website and Isso are on the same server, the nginx
configuration looks like this:
.. code-block:: nginx
server {
listen [::]:80 default ipv6only=off;
server_name example.tld;
root ...;
}
server {
listen [::]:80;
server_name comments.example.tld;
location / {
proxy_pass http://localhost:8080;
proxy_set_header X-Forwarded-For $proxy_add_x_forwarded_for;
proxy_set_header Host $host;
}
}
Now, you embed Isso to your website:
.. code-block:: html
<script data-isso="http://comments.example.tld/"
src="http://comments.example.tld/js/embed.min.js"></script>
<section id="isso-thread"></section>
Note, that `data-isso` is optional, but when a website includes a script using
``async`` it is no longer possible to determine the script's external URL.
That's it. When you open your website, you should see a commenting form. Leave
a comment to see if the setup works. If not, see :doc:`troubleshooting`.
.. _Nginx: http://nginx.org/
.. _CORS: https://developer.mozilla.org/en/docs/HTTP/Access_control_CORS
Deployment
----------
Isso ships with a built-in web server, which is useful for the initial setup.
But it is not recommended to use the built-in web server for production. A few
WSGI servers are supported out-of-the-box:
* gevent_, coroutine-based network library
* uWSGI_, full-featured uWSGI server
* gunicorn_, Python WSGI HTTP Server for UNIX
.. _gevent: http://www.gevent.org/
.. _uWSGI: http://uwsgi-docs.readthedocs.org/en/latest/
.. _gunicorn: http://gunicorn.org/
gevent
^^^^^^
Probably the easiest deployment method. Install with PIP (requires libevent):
.. code-block:: sh
$ pip install gevent
Then, just use the ``isso`` executable as usual. Gevent monkey-patches Python's
standard library to work with greenlets.
To execute Isso, just use the commandline interface:
.. code-block:: sh
$ isso -c my.cfg run
Unfortunately, gevent 0.13.2 does not support UNIX domain sockets (see `#295
<https://github.com/surfly/gevent/issues/295>`_ and `#299
<https://github.com/surfly/gevent/issues/299>`_ for details).
uWSGI
^^^^^
The author's favourite WSGI server. Due the complexity of uWSGI, there is a
:doc:`separate document <extras/uwsgi>` on how to setup uWSGI for use
with Isso.
gunicorn
^^^^^^^^
Install gunicorn_ via PIP:
.. code-block:: sh
$ pip install gunicorn
To execute Isso, use a command similar to:
.. code-block:: sh
$ export ISSO_SETTINGS="/path/to/isso.cfg"
$ gunicorn -b localhost:8080 -w 4 --preload isso
